Holidays that government agencies, some k-12 schools, some colleges, and some univeristies have off:

Monday 9/4 (Labor Day)

CA admission's Day is 9/9 - not often given as a holiday anymore but some places still do - that means the holiday would be on 9/8 (but shouldn't be a major travel weekend)

Monday 10/9 (Columbus Day)

Friday 11/10 (for Veteran's Day)

Thurs/Fri 11/23 -11/24 - some places also have Wed 11/22 off - next year this could change as our university is thinking about giving the whole week off next year as are others (so the total days for Thanksgiving may vary)

Then depending on the school - Winter break periods start early December and run thru the end of January or beg of Feb.

All bets are off for year around schools - I don't know those schedules - they would have kids off for bigger chunks
